Louise Brooking Whitaker, 89, of Orange, Virginia, died on Monday, August 17, 2026, from complications of a perforated bowel. She spent her final days at home, surrounded and visited by friends and family, and passed peacefully and comfortably with her family by her side.
Louise was born in Orange County on June 17, 1937, and was the daughter of the late William Wood Brooking and Nora Pannill Brooking. She was preceded in death by a brother, Eugene Brooking and his wife, Charlotte; and two sisters, Edna B. Altman and her husband, Ted, and Willie Wood B. Biscoe and her husband, George.
Louise is survived by her husband of 63 years, Gene Allen Whitaker; a daughter, Betty Morton Whitaker of Alexandria; a son, Eric Campbell Whitaker of Los Angeles, California; a brother, Jim Brooking and his wife, Susan, of Orange; a sister, Jane Vanderburg of Richmond; and numerous nieces and nephews.
Louise was a graduate of Madison College, a devoted member of Orange Presbyterian Church, and a retired math teacher. She spent the majority of her teaching career in Loudoun County, Virginia, where she taught for two decades before retiring. Louise was also a devoted gardener who took great joy and pride in her beautiful flower garden.
During her final days, Louise shared a belief that guided the way she lived: “Our purpose in life is to take care of each other.” She exemplified those words throughout her life—in the care and encouragement she gave generations of students, in the love she shared with her children and family, and in her generous service to others. For nearly 25 years, she volunteered at the Love Outreach Food Pantry and faithfully supported her church, her community, and numerous charitable organizations.
